1、2022年考博英语-中国海洋大学考前提分综合测验卷(附带答案及详解)1. 单选题Excuse me, but it is time to have your temperature( ).问题1选项A.takeB.takingC.to takeD.taken【答案】D【解析】句意:打扰一下,该量体温了。语法题。考查宾语补足语。题干考查 “使役动词have+宾语your temperature +宾语补足语”结构,此处的宾语temperature和宾语补足语take之间是被动关系,故使用过去分词taken。2. 单选题There is no point ( )the game, unless y

2、ou practice every day.问题1选项A.to learn to playB.by learning to playC.in learning to playD.having learned to play【答案】C【解析】句意:除非你天天练习,不然学玩游戏是没有意义的。考查固定搭配。There is no point in doing sth. 做某事没意义。3. 单选题While some business executives repeated their objections to the new smoking restrictions, others said th

3、ey wanted more time to ( )the impact of todays decision.问题1选项A.attestB.obtainC.affectD.weigh【答案】D【解析】句意:一些企业经管人员对新的吸烟限制条件表示反对,另外一部分人表示需要更多的时间去权衡如今决定的影响。考查动词辨析。Attest证明,证实; obtain获得; affect影响,感染,感动; weigh权衡,考虑,称重量。故D符合句意。4. 单选题The new principal hopes to ( )a number of changes to the courses of study.

4、问题1选项A.affectB.effectC.reactD.influence【答案】B【解析】句意:这位新校长希望对学习课程进行一些改变。考查动词辨析。Affect影响,感染; effect使发生,实现,引起; react起反应,(对)作出反应,回应; influence影响,对起作用,支配。故B符合句意。5. 单选题Successful innovations have driven many older technologies to extinction and have resulted in higher productivity, greater consumption mate

5、rials through the economy and increased quantities of metals and other substances in use per capita. The history of industrial development abounds with examples.In 1870, horses and mules were the prime source of power on US farms. One horse or mule was required to support four human beings a ration

6、that remained almost constant for many decades. At that time, had a national commission been asked to forecast the horse and mule population for 1970, its answer probably would have depended on whether its consultants were of an economic or technological turn of mind. Had they been “economists”, the

7、y would probably have projected the 1970 horse or mule population to be more than 50 million. Had they been “technologists”,they would have recognized that the power of steam had already been harnessed to industry and to land and ocean transport. They would have recognized further that it would be o

8、nly a matter of time before steam would be the prime source of power on the farm. It would have been difficult for them to avoid the conclusion that the horse and mule population would decline rapidly.1.According to the passage, what supplied most of the power on U.S. farms in 1870?2.Which of the fo

9、llowing is NOT mentioned by the author as a consequence of new technological developments?3.It can be inferred from the passage that by 1870( ).4.In the second paragraph, the author suggests that “economists” would( ).5.What is the authors attitude toward changes brought on by technological innovati

10、on?问题1选项A.AnimalsB.HumansC.EnginesD.Water问题2选项A.Older technologies die away.B.The quality of life is improved.C.Overall productivity increasedD.More raw materials become necessary问题3选项A.technology began to be more commercialB.the steam engine had been inventedC.the U.S. horse population was about 10

11、 millionD.a national commission on agriculture had been established问题4选项A.plan the economy through yearly forecastsB.fail to consider the influence of technological innovationC.value the economic contribution of farm animalsD.consult for the national commission on the economy问题5选项A.He is excited abo

12、ut themB.He accepts them as naturalC.He is disturbed by themD.He questions their usefulness【答案】第1题:A第2题:B第3题:B第4题:B第5题:B【解析】1.细节事实题。第二段指出: In 1870, horses and mules were the prime source of power on US farms (在1870年,马和骡子是美国农场的主要劳动力),由此可知A项“动物”正确。2.细节事实题。题干问的是:下列哪项不属于作者所述技术革新的结果?第一段指出: Successful inn

13、ovations have driven many older technologies to extinction and have resulted in higher productivity, greater consumption materials through the economy (成功的新发明让很多较旧的技术消失,带来了更高的生产力,通过经济发展带来更多数量的消耗材料)。故作者并未提及B项“人的生活质量得到 了改善”。3.判断推理题。第二段指出: .they would have recognized that the power of steam had already

14、 been harnessed to industry and to land and ocean transport (他们将认识到蒸汽动力已被使用到工业、土地和海洋运输)。由此推测B项“蒸汽引擎已被发明”正确。4.判断推理题。根据题干关键词“economists”定位至第二段: Had they been “economists”,they would probably have projected the 1970 horse or mule population to be more than 50 million (如果他们是经济学家,那么他们会认为到1970年马或骡子的数量要达到5
